Default Machine Shop Damage To Cam Bearings - Serious?

Audi A4 1.8L
Hello everyone,
I might be wrong but it looks like my machine shop damaged 2 cam bearing areas in the head - rear or last exhaust cam bearing and 1 intake bearing.
There are 4 pictures- 2 of the damage done to the rear exhaust cam bearing surface (looks like the aluminum is peeled up) and 2 of the damage on the intake cam at the number 11 lifter bore / cam bearing.
Damages are in the red circled areas. Both pairs of pictures are different views of the same areas.
My question is does the damage look serious enough to cause failure or premature failure?
